Crochet a cosy hot water bottle cover
1 comment
This design challenges the rather frumpy image of a hot water bottle cover! Now you can keep snug without compromising your street cred
Materials
Rowan Calmer: 1 x 50g.
I used Coral (A).
Small amounts of Kiwi (B) and Khaki (C).
Hook
5mm
Tension
14 htr and 10 rows to 10 cm/4in.Abbreviations
Htr2tog: leaving last loop of each st on hook work 1htr into each of next 2 sts, yrh and pull through all 3 loops.
Pattern
Hot water bottle cover

Using A, make 29ch.
Foundation row: 1dc into 2nd ch from hook,
1dc into each ch. 28dc.
Row 1: 2ch, 1htr into each dc.
Row 2: 2ch, 1htr into each htr.
Rows 3-7: As row 2, changing to B during last st
of row 7.
Row 8: 1ch, 1dc into each htr, changing to C during last st of row.
Row 9: 1ch, 1dc into each dc, changing to A during last st of row.
Row 10: 2ch, 1htr into each dc.
Row 11: 2ch, htr2tog, 1htr into each htr to last
2 sts, htr2tog.
Rows 12-13: As row 11. 22 sts.
Row 14: As row 2. Mark each end of last row with a contrast thread.
Row 15: As row 2.
Row 16: 2ch, 2htr into next htr, 1htr into each htr to last st, 2htr into last st.
Rows 17-18: As row 16. 28 sts.
Rows 19-33: As row 2.
Row 34: 2ch, [htr2tog] twice, 1htr into each htr to last 4 sts, [htr2tog] twice.
Row 35: As row 34.
Row 36: 2ch, [htr2tog] 3 times, 1htr into each htr to last 6 sts, [htr2tog] 3 times. 14 sts.
Rows 37-39: As row 2, changing to B during last st of row 39.
Row 40: 1ch, 1dc into each htr, changing to C
during last st.
Row 41: 1ch, 1dc into each dc, changing to A
during last st of row.
Row 42: As row 1.
Row 43: As row 16. 16 sts.
Rows 44-45: As row 2. Mark each end of last row with a contrast thread.
Rows 46-47: As row 2.
Row 48: As row 11. 14 sts.
Row 49: As row 2, changing to C during last st.
Row 50: As row 40 and changing to B during
last st.
Row 51: As row 41 and changing to A during
last st.
Row 52: As row 1.
Rows 53-54: As row 2.
Row 55: 2ch, 2htr into each of next 3htr, 1htr into each htr to last 3htr, 2htr into each htr. 20 sts.
Rows 56-57: 2ch, 2htr into each of next 2htr, 1htr into each htr to last 2htr, 2htr into each htr. 28 sts.
Rows 58-64: As row 2.
Fasten off.
